Potentially Lethal Designer Drugs: Synthetic Cannabis and the Fatal Appeal
The rise of synthetic cannabinoids, commonly known as K2, presents a significant threat to public well-being. These illicit substances, often distributed as a legal alternative to marijuana, are actually blends of crushed plant matter sprayed with potent psychoactive chemicals. Their attraction often stems from perceived lower price and easy availability, but users are unaware of the erratic effects and extremely dangerous consequences. Because the chemical compositions change widely between batches, each use is a risk with unknown and frequently awful outcomes, leading to severe health problems and even passing.
